Alternative careers for Photographers
People searching for career moves out of Photographers usually want two things at once: work that still uses familiar skills, and work that is less exposed to Generative AI. This matrix ranks other occupations by shared O*NET Detailed Work Activities, then filters toward lower AI vulnerability scores than the current 38/100 for Photographers.
Overlap is Jaccard similarity on Detailed Work Activities (DWAs) — a shared federal taxonomy of work verbs, not fuzzy title matching. Preferred matches need AI risk under 30 and DWA overlap of at least 50%. In the pilot catalog, when those strict matches are scarce, we expand the filter and disclose the fallback.
The strongest overlap in this set is Producers and Directors (12% shared activities, AI risk 38, median pay $90,360). Compare wage and growth before switching — a lower AI score is not automatically a raise.

How to use this matrix
- Prefer matches with positive DWA overlap — those reuse skills you already practice.
- Check whether median pay and BLS growth are acceptable tradeoffs for lower AI exposure.
- Open the destination occupation’s task page to see which duties remain human-led.
- Treat fallback matches (thin overlap) as directional, not as guaranteed skill transfers.
